WAFCON2024: NFF adds video analyst, Krulj, to Super Falcons

Swedish match video analyst, Igor Krulj, has been appointed to the role for nine-time African champions as they gear up for the 2024 WAFCON in Morocco, www.aclsports.com reports. 

Krulj, a UEFA Pro License holder and chief scout at IFK Värnamo, is expected to provide tactical insight as Nigeria targets a 10th WAFCON title.

With years of experience in Swedish elite football, Krulj has served as head coach of Halmstads BK and as both coach and sporting director at Örgryte IS.

He joins a growing list of experienced specialists on the Falcons’ technical crew, including fitness coach Per Karlsson, who rejoined the team in May for a friendly against Cameroon in Abeokuta.

The 13th edition of the WAFCON runs from July 5 to 26, 2025. Nigeria has been drawn into Group B and will begin its campaign on July 6 against Tunisia, before facing Algeria and Botswana, all matches scheduled to be played in Casablanca.

Krulj will work alongside head coach Justin Madugu, assistant coach Ann Agumanu-Chiejine, fitness coach Per Karlsson, and goalkeeper trainer Auwal Makwalla, as the Super Falcons finalize preparations for the continental tournament.
